Understanding the Benefits of Cars And Truck Glass Tinting
Numerous automobile owners may forget it, car glass tinting deals countless advantages that expand beyond appearances. One of the key advantages is UV protection; tinting can block as much as 99% of dangerous ultraviolet rays. This greatly minimizes the danger of skin damage for passengers and shields the vehicle's inside from fading and cracking.Additionally, colored windows enhance personal privacy and security by making it more tough for outsiders to see inside the lorry. This can discourage prospective burglary and supply a more comfy setting for occupants.Moreover, vehicle glass tinting improves temperature level policy, keeping the interior cooler throughout heat, which can enhance total driving comfort. It also decreases glare from the sunlight, enabling safer driving problems. In conclusion, automobile glass tinting is not merely a stylistic selection; it offers functional advantages that contribute to the safety, convenience, and long life of the car.

Legal Considerations for Home Window Tinting
What are the lawful effects of window tinting for car owners? Regulations controling window tinting differ significantly by state and nation, requiring that proprietors validate neighborhood regulations prior to applying tint. A lot of territories define permissible degrees of color darkness, frequently determined by Visible Light Transmission (VLT) percentages. Front windshields generally have stricter policies than side and rear windows.Failure to adhere to these laws may result in fines, mandatory removal of illegal tint, or automobile assessments. Furthermore, some locations need certain certification for the tinting movie utilized, guaranteeing it fulfills security requirements. Automobile owners must likewise think about prospective exemptions for clinical reasons, which might enable darker color under particular scenarios. Eventually, recognizing these legal factors to consider is crucial for lorry owners to avoid unnecessary fines and warranty compliance with local laws.
Maintenance Tips for Tinted Windows
Tinted home windows improve a vehicle's look and convenience, appropriate maintenance is crucial to confirm their durability and effectiveness. Routine cleaning is essential; however, it is necessary to make use of a soft microfiber cloth and a gentle, ammonia-free cleaner to prevent damaging the color. Abrasive materials or rough chemicals can cause fading.drivers and scratches ought to additionally avoid rolling down the home windows for a minimum of 48 hours after setup to permit the sticky to treat appropriately. Furthermore, vehicle parking in shaded locations or making use of sunshades can stop too much warmth exposure, which may degrade the color over time.Inspecting the color for any kind of bubbles, scratches, or peeling is essential; dealing with these problems without delay can prevent additional damages. Routine maintenance by a specialist can validate that the color remains in prime condition, supplying both visual advantages and efficient UV security for the automobile's inside.

Color Type Rates
Countless elements affect the pricing of automobile glass tinting services, specifically the type of color chosen. Colors vary considerably in expense, largely due to their product structure and efficiency qualities. Dyed tints are normally the most affordable choice however offer limited UV defense. Conversely, ceramic tints are a lot more pricey due to their exceptional warmth rejection and durability. Furthermore, crossbreed tints, which integrate residential properties of both colored and metalized films, frequently drop in the mid-range rate category. Moreover, the brand name and service warranty related to the color can influence pricing, as premium brands may regulate greater rates for their boosted attributes. Because of this, picking the right color kind can considerably affect the overall cost of the tinting service.
